pdf file which gives gs cannot display or convert to ps
this applies to current HEAD.
The attached pdf file displays fine in acroread, okular, xpdf, but gs segfaults
with this commandline (pdf2ps)
$ gs -q -dNOPAUSE -DBATCH -P- -DSAFER -sDEVICE=pswrite -sOutputFile=foo.ps -c
save pop -f integrating_AB.pdf
Segmentation fault
and exits with error when trying to display the pdf
$ gs integrating_AB.pdf
GPL Ghostscript SVN PRE-RELEASE 9.01 (2010-09-14)
Copyright (C) 2010 Artifex Software, Inc. All rights reserved.
This software comes with NO WARRANTY: see the file PUBLIC for details.
Processing pages 1 through 1.
Page 1
Error: /rangecheck in --run--
